How can architecture contribute to maintaining local cultural diversity in rural China? As well as respond to the competing influence of globalization and retaining the local culture? And how do we re-understand the relationship between “rural” and “city”? 

The main purpose of this project is to investigate Chinese villages in a state of transition, exploring the key problems, and evolve design methods and strategies for the future difficulties faced by China’s rural development.

Intervene in the Yanjing village through programs at different scales, becomes a new billboard for the village, and speculate ahead the future scenario in this village, which China's rural areas will become one of the most coveted places to live in the country.
